Asisten pembelajaran matematika pintar yang ditenagai oleh Google Gemini AI. Dirancang untuk membantu siswa memahami konsep matematika dengan cara yang interaktif dan menyenangkan.
- π€ Berbasis Google Gemini AI (upgrade dari Ollama + Qwen)
- π Penjelasan step-by-step yang mudah dipahami
- π Contoh soal yang relevan
- π‘ Pendekatan pembelajaran yang adaptif
- π Dukungan Bahasa Indonesia
- β‘ Respons cepat dan akurat
- π Fitur retry otomatis untuk koneksi yang stabil
- π§Ή Fitur clear screen untuk antarmuka yang bersih
Sebelumnya:
- Menggunakan Ollama + Qwen
- Memerlukan server lokal
- Setup yang lebih kompleks
Sekarang:
- Menggunakan Google Gemini
- Cloud-based, tanpa perlu server lokal
- Setup lebih sederhana
- Performa lebih stabil
pip install google-generativeai
pip install langchain-core
pip install tenacity
- Dapatkan API key dari Google AI Studio
- Ganti
YOUR_API_KEY
dengan API key Anda di filemath_guru.py
:
GOOGLE_API_KEY = "YOUR_API_KEY"
- Download atau clone repository ini
git clone https://github.com/username/math-guru-ai.git
cd math-guru-ai
- Jalankan aplikasi
python3 math_guru.py
Setelah aplikasi berjalan:
- Ketik pertanyaan matematika Anda dalam Bahasa Indonesia
- Tunggu respons dari AI
- Gunakan perintah khusus:
- Ketik
clear
untuk membersihkan layar - Ketik
keluar
untuk mengakhiri sesi
- Ketik
Kontribusi selalu diterima! Cara berkontribusi:
- Fork repository ini
- Buat branch baru (
git checkout -b fitur-baru
) - Commit perubahan Anda (
git commit -m 'Menambahkan fitur baru'
) - Push ke branch tersebut (
git push origin fitur-baru
) - Buat Pull Request
Proyek ini dilisensikan di bawah MIT License - lihat file LICENSE untuk detail.
Jika Anda menemukan masalah atau memiliki pertanyaan:
- Buat issue di repository ini
- Hubungi kami melalui email di: kontak@classy.id